Cells can interact with other cells?

Respuesta :

sakimakidomo
sakimakidomo sakimakidomo
  • 15-07-2019

Answer:

Yes. Cells have 'cell receptors' that are used to receive messengers like hormones to communicate. Cell receptors have specific shapes that fit the shape of the messenger that they want to receive. Organs like the pancreas send our these messengers to the cells to order them to do different functions.
